P2P client

#!/usr/bin/python3 | |
import socket | |
import threading | |
from time import sleep | |
max_peers = 4 | |
port = 3333 | |
thread_list = [] | |
sock_list = {} | |
def make_server_socket(port): | |
s = socket.socket(socket.AF_INET, socket.SOCK_STREAM) | |
s.setsockopt(socket.SOL_SOCKET, socket.SO_REUSEADDR, 1) | |
s.bind(('0.0.0.0', port)) | |
s.listen(5) | |
return s | |
def client_recieve_data(sock): | |
data = "null".encode() | |
while data.decode() != '': | |
data = sock.recv(32767) | |
print("\r" + data.decode() + "\nyou: ", end="") | |
sock.close() | |
def broadcast(server_socket, sender_ip, message): | |
global sock_list | |
for ip, sock in sock_list.items(): | |
if ip != sender_ip: | |
msg = sender_ip + "> " + message.decode() | |
sock.send(msg.encode()) | |
def server_read_input(sock): | |
data = "null" | |
while data != "exit" and data != "": | |
data = input("you: ") | |
broadcast(sock, "server", data.encode()) | |
sock.close() | |
def handle_client(serv_sock, client_socket, client_ip): | |
global max_peers | |
global sock_list | |
x = "null".encode() | |
while x.decode() != '': | |
x = client_socket.recv(32767) | |
broadcast(serv_sock, client_ip, x) | |
print("\r" + client_ip + "> " + x.decode() + "\nyou: ", end="") | |
client_socket.close() | |
sock_list.pop(client_ip, 0) | |
max_peers += 1 | |
def run_server(): | |
global thread_list | |
global max_peers | |
global port | |
sock = make_server_socket(port) | |
thread = threading.Thread(target=server_read_input, args=[sock]) | |
thread_list += [thread] | |
thread.start() | |
while True: | |
socket, address = sock.accept() | |
ip, port = address | |
ip = ip + ":" + str(port) | |
sock_list[ip] = socket | |
print("\rConnected to: " + ip + "\nyou: ", end="") | |
thread = threading.Thread(target=handle_client, args=[sock, socket, ip]) | |
thread_list += [thread] | |
thread.start() | |
max_peers -= 1 | |
while max_peers == 0: | |
sleep(2) | |
print("Waiting for other threads") | |
for t in thread_list: | |
t.join() | |
def run_client(): | |
ip = input("Enter IP: ") | |
sock = socket.socket(socket.AF_INET, socket.SOCK_STREAM) | |
sock.connect((ip, port)) | |
print('Connected to server') | |
thread = threading.Thread(target=client_recieve_data, args=[sock]) | |
thread.start() | |
data = "null" | |
while data != "exit" and data != "": | |
data = input("you: ") | |
sock.send(data.encode()) | |
thread.join() | |
sock.close() | |
try: | |
start = "" | |
while start != "s" and start != "c": | |
start = input("(S)tart/(C)onnect server? ").lower()[0] | |
if start == 's': | |
run_server() | |
else: | |
run_client() | |
except socket.error as msg: | |
print('Bind failed. Error Code : ' + str(msg) + ' Message ') | |
run_client() | |
except KeyboardInterrupt: | |
exit(0) |
